“As a Nexus resident for close to two years and counting, I strongly feel that the complex is getting a raw deal on this site. This is one of a large number of apartment complexes in the Orenco Station area, and I assume that the main audience for these reviews is people who are moving to this area and deciding between those complexes. Good news for those people: all of the negative reviews about parking and towing are irrelevant to you! If you live here, you can park here, and your friends, with one of the two passes you get, can park here too. When I got a job in Hillsboro, I looked at all the apartments between the Max stop and New Seasons. The first thing I noticed was that Vector and Hub 9 had the highest reviews; the second thing I noticed was that neither apartment is air conditioned. Priorities may vary between residents, but for me, no air conditioning in a city with many 90-plus-degree summer days is an instant deal breaker. Those buildings look pretty, but that's useless to those of us who want to live comfortably in our apartments during summer. Nexus is air conditioned, which moved it to the top of my list. I've been happy with Nexus the entire time I've lived here. The office staff is friendly. The fire alarms you'll read about in the reviews here haven't been a problem in my experience - I have heard them go off in other Nexus buildings (never in my building), but during summer I hear fire alarms go off in the other apartment complexes across the street even more often. The apartments are spacious - they don't have the fancy interior design of a couple other nearby buildings, but when you bring friends over, they'll still say, "Nice place." Rent does increase every time I renew my lease, but this is standard throughout Orenco Station and I don't count it as a negative against Nexus. Among other positives, the maintenance staff regularly responds to requests on weekends, there is valet trash pickup, and the location between the Max and New Seasons is incredible. Above all, I'd advise those shopping for a place to rent in the Orenco area to look beyond the average star rating and look at the specific pros and cons of each place. For me, the decision was easy.”
